Recently, the "Code for the Construction of Online Carbon Emission Monitoring System" jointly drafted by Taizhou Ecological Environment Bureau, Taizhou Municipal Market Supervision Bureau, Taizhou Standardization Institute and other units was officially released. It is understood that this is also the first municipal local standard in the field of carbon emission monitoring in China.
The "Specification" puts forward specific requirements for the direct monitoring system, data collection and transmission system, data accounting and verification system, and real-time monitoring and monitoring platform covered by the online carbon emission monitoring system, and stipulates the construction principles, system composition and composition, technical requirements and performance indicators, station requirements, installation requirements and system evaluation of the carbon emission online monitoring system. Among them, the technical requirements of four important performance indicators of indication error, system response time, zero drift and range drift technology, as well as the technical requirements of six accuracy levels such as gaseous pollutants, oxygen and particulate matter are quantified, which provides professional and operable business guidance and normative guidance for the construction of carbon emission online monitoring system.
The Code will come into effect on January 30, 2023.
